密码分类例:令密钥k=(73) 且gcd(726)=1. 明文hot=(71419)加密:(7 × 7 3) mod 26 = 0(7 × 14 3) mod 26 =23(7 × 19 3) mod 26 =6密文为(0236)=(axg)解密:7-1=15=-11 mod 26(0- 3) × 15 mod 26 = 7(23- 3) × 15 mod 26 =14(6- 3) ×
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级1第二章 古典密码2补充内容-密码算法的分类保密内容受限制的(restricted)算法 算法的保密性基于保持算法的秘密 基于密钥(key-based)的算法 算法的保密性基于对密钥的保密3补充内容-密码算法的
上节回顾加密算法密钥 K<Ke Kd>上节回顾1——信息论911算法安全性①公开设计原则:密码的安全只依赖于密钥的保密不依赖于算法的保密②理论上绝对安全的密码是存在的:一次一密③理论上任何实用的密码都是可破的④我们追求的是计算上的安全⑤计算上的安全:使用可利用的计算资源不能破译 20例如:格孔密写
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级Page: 古典密码学杨秋伟湖南大学 计算机与通信学院432022Page: 1古典密码学组成古典替换密码体制古典单码加密法古典多码加密法古典换位密码体制古典置换加密法4320222古典单码加密法:概述单码加密是一种替换加密法其中的每个明文只能被唯一的一个密文字母所替换例一:在给定的加密法中明文的字母a在密文中可能总是显示为n
2密钥K解密算法D5一对称密码模型二密码分析二密码分析ak7r142422五轮转机Rotor Machine习 题
第3章 古典密码诗情画意传密语隐写术(信息隐藏)的另外一些例子 F:对应着C K:对应着H L:对应着I Q:对应着N D:对应着A即FKLQD经Caesar密码解密恢复为CHINA(不区分大小写) 密钥: 7-1(mod 26)=15 加密函数:解密函数:设明文:China首先转换为数字:278130 原始消息China得到恢复 多表代替密
实验2 古典密码1.实验目的(1)了解古典密码中的基本加密运算(2)了解几种典型的古典密码体制(3)掌握古典密码的统计分析方法2.实验内容(1)古典密码体制① 简单移位加密(单表代换)该加密方法中加密时将明文中的每个字母向前推移K位经典恺撒密码加密变换就是这种变换取k=3步骤1:打开CAP4软件并加载实验一附带的如图2-1所示图2-1 加载文件步骤2:采用恺撒加密方法手工加密打开CAP4菜
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级2.1 流密码的基本概念2.2 线性反馈移位寄存器2.3 线性移位寄存器的一元多项式表示2.4 m序列的伪随机性2.5 m序列密码的破译2.6 非线性序列 第2章 流密码20224212.1 流密码的基本概念流密码的基本思想y=y0y1y2…=Ez0(x0)Ez1(x1)Ez2(x2)…密钥流z=z0z1…明文
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级北邮现代密码学单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级北邮现代密码学1分组密码(二)《现代密码学》第四讲上讲内容回顾分组密码定义分组密码的发展历史保密系统的安全性分析及分组密码的攻击本节主要内容DES算法的整体结构——Feistel结构DES算法的轮函数DES算法的密钥编排算法DES的解密变换D
单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级单击此处编辑母版标题样式单击此处编辑母版文本样式第二级第三级第四级第五级1分组密码(二)《现代密码学》第四讲上讲内容回顾分组密码定义分组密码的发展历史保密系统的安全性分析及分组密码的攻击本节主要内容DES算法的整体结构——Feistel结构DES算法的轮函数DES算法的密钥编排算法DES的解密变换DES算法的整体结构——Fei
违法有害信息,请在下方选择原因提交举报